We review the class of implicit algebraic constitutive relations for fluids which includes in its ambit those whose material properties depend on the invariants of the stress, the symmetric part of the velocity gradient, as well as their mixed invariants. Such constitutive relations can describe the response of complex fluids whose material properties depend on the mechanical pressure, shear rate, etc. The class of models under consideration can describe the non-monotone relationship between the shear stress and the shear rate observed in experiments on colloids, as well as other novel response characteristics of non-Newtonian fluids. Constitutive relations for power-law fluids, generalized Stokesian fluids and Piezo-viscous fluids are special sub-classes of the class of fluids considered herein.
